While Members of Parliament have been shying away from making any comments on the impasse between President Mokgweetsi Masisi and his predecessor Ian Khama, Lerala/Maunatlala legislator Prince Maele has broken the silence.

Maele thwarted The Monitor’s attempts to seek clarity on the remarks he made at a meeting addressed by Khama in Goo-Moremi on Friday. He however declined to comment stating that he would not discuss anything in relation to what he had said.

Khama shared a video clip of Maele giving closing remarks at a meeting where he (Khama) was having a meal with residents and also handing out donations to the elderly.

Gov’t must rectify recognition of Khama as Kgosi

While it is widely acknowledged that Khama holds the title of Kgosi, the government’s failure to properly gazette his recognition has raised serious concerns about adherence to legal procedures and the credibility of traditional leadership.
